下列对PC寄存器描述,错误的是( )
A: PC也称为程序指针计数器
B: 机器指令在存储器中对应的地址码,就是存储在PC之中;
C: 取指令结束以后,需要修改PC保存的内容,修改量取决于指令字长和存储器的编址方式
D: 在机器指令中,不能够显式使用PC寄存器
A: PC也称为程序指针计数器
B: 机器指令在存储器中对应的地址码,就是存储在PC之中;
C: 取指令结束以后,需要修改PC保存的内容,修改量取决于指令字长和存储器的编址方式
D: 在机器指令中,不能够显式使用PC寄存器
D
举一反三
- 下列对PC寄存器描述,正确的是 A: PC也称为程序指针计数器 B: 机器指令在存储器中对应的地址码,就是存储在PC之中 C: 取指令结束以后,需要修改PC保存的内容,修改量取决于指令字长和存储器的编址方式 D: 程序执行过程中其值不会减小
- 下列关于指令寄存器PC的描述,正确的是() A: 一条指令周期内PC的值可能改变2次 B: 指令执行阶段PC的值对应下一条指令的地址 C: 取指令结束以后,需要修改PC的值,修改量取决于指令字长和存储器的编址方式 D: 程序执行过程中其值也可能会减小
- 在CPU 中保存当前正在执行的指令的寄存器是_____ ,保存下一条指令地址的寄存器是_______ ,保存CPU访存地址的寄存器是______。 A: 其余都不对 B: 程序计数器PC,指令寄存器IR,存储器地址寄存器MAR C: 指令寄存器IR,存储器地址寄存器MAR,程序计数器PC D: 指令寄存器IR,程序计数器PC,存储器地址寄存器MAR
- CPU中保存当前正在执行指令的寄存器是()。 A: 指令寄存器IR B: 程序计数器PC C: 累加器ACC D: 存储地址寄存器MAR
- 下列关于程序计数器PC的描述中错误的是() A: PC不属于特殊功能寄存器 B: PC中的计数值可被编程指令修改 C: PC可寻址64KBRAM空间 D: PC中存放着下一条指令的首地址
内容
- 0
设机器字长为16位,存储器按字节编址,设PC=1000H,当读取一条双字长指令后,PC=_____
- 1
PC指针的工作过程:当CPU取指令时,PC内容为所取指令的地址,程序存储器按此地址输出指令字节,同时PC指针自动加1
- 2
CPU中不包括()。 A: 存储地址寄存器MAR B: 指令寄存器IR C: I/O逻辑 D: 程序计数器PC
- 3
存放当前执行指令的寄存器是______,存放欲执行指令地址的寄存器是程序计数器(PC)。 A: 程序计数器(PC) B: 数据寄存器(MDR) C: 指令寄存器(IR) D: 地址寄存器(MAR)
- 4
处理器中的PC寄存器称为程序计数器,其中存储着处理器下一条将要执行指令的地址。()